Croatia-Austria Trade: In 2023, Croatia exported $1.24B to Austria. The main products that Croatia exported to Austria were Insulated Wire ($112M), Railway Freight Cars ($82.2M), and Electrical Resistors ($50.9M). Over the past 5 years the exports of Croatia to Austria have increased at an annualized rate of 3.24%, from $1.06B in 2018 to $1.24B in 2023.
In 2020, Croatia exported services to Austria worth $780M, with Travel ($642M), Other business services ($68.8M), and Computer and information services ($37.2M) being the largest in terms of value.
Austria-Croatia Trade: In 2023, Austria exported $2.35B to Croatia. The main products that Austria exported to Croatia were Tanned Equine and Bovine Hides ($101M), Packaged Medicaments ($79.7M), and Gold ($52.3M). Over the past 5 years the exports of Austria to Croatia have increased at an annualized rate of 3.87%, from $1.94B in 2018 to $2.35B in 2023.
In 2020, Austria exported services to Croatia worth $355M, with Other business services ($91.4M), Travel ($70.8M), and Transportation ($65.1M) being the largest in terms of value.
Comparison: In 2023, Croatia ranked 34 in the Economic Complexity Index (ECI 0.76), and 75 in total exports ($22.5B). That same year, Austria ranked 8 in the Economic Complexity Index (ECI 1.56), and 31 in total exports ($204B).
